Quenneville to the Devils (update: Aho to Bridgeport)

The Islanders have traded David Quenneville and a 2021 second-round pick to New Jersey for veteran defenseman Andy Greene. Quenneville goes to Binghamton, and if that ding from blocking a shot the other night isn’t bad, he could return in two weeks: The B-Devils visit Bridgeport on March 1. His older brother, John, is a former Devil, traded to the Blackhawks over the summer for Greenwich’s John Hayden. We’ll see if they can get Peter there someday and complete the set.

The Islanders haven’t announced the Corresponding Transaction to clear room on their 23-man roster. There was talk last night of putting Sebastian Aho in the lineup, but one wonders if that has changed. Edit, 5:25: It has. The Islanders have sent Aho back to Bridgeport.
